The VUB will build a center of expertise in combat sports on its Etterbeek campus

In the future center of expertise, training will take place in two rooms. One of them will be equipped with a fixed and mobile boxing ring and punching bags, and the other with tatami mats for judo, karate and taekwondo. The Brussels combat sports clubs and the Flemish Boxing League will be able to train there. These spaces will be built next to the existing sports infrastructure of the VUB, which will make it possible to share parking spaces, showers, changing rooms and reception.

The VEC will also have a space devoted to education and research. The VUB’s “Sport&Society” research group, which has been studying the social added value of sport and how to optimize it for years, will provide (together with other VUB scientists) support and training programs “specific training” to the different organizations that will work on the VEC. Thanks to this, young people will be better supported and encouraged.

The VUB foresees a cost of four million euros for all the works. The project is supported by the Flemish government with 725,000 euros, the Flemish Fund of Brussels (700,000 euros) and the Flemish Boxing League (250,000 euros). The rest will be paid for by the university.
